跨平台移动应用程序的需求越来越大。而HTML5作为一种通用的标记语言,具有跨平台的优势,成为构建跨平台移动应用程序的首选。本文将介绍如何使用HTML5开发跨平台移动应用程序的网站。
一、了解HTML5
HTML5是Hyper Text Markup Language的新版本,它不仅具有丰富的标签和属性,还支持多媒体元素、图形绘制、本地存储等功能。此外,HTML5还具有很好的兼容性和可扩展性,可以适应各种设备和浏览器。
二、使用HTML5开发移动应用程序
创建页面结构
使用HTML5的语义化标签来创建页面结构,例如
、
、
、
等,使得页面结构清晰且易于维护。
添加样式和动画
使用CSS3来添加样式和动画效果,例如背景色、边框、阴影、渐变等。此外,还可以使用CSS3的媒体查询来实现响应式设计。
添加交互元素
使用JavaScript来添加交互元素,例如按钮、表单、轮播图等。JavaScript还可以用于处理用户输入、验证表单数据、实现页面导航等。
集成原生组件
使用HTML5的Web Components技术,可以将原生的组件库集成到移动应用程序中,例如按钮、表单、地图等。这些组件库通常使用JavaScript和CSS实现,具有很好的可定制性和可扩展性。
三、使用工具和框架加速开发
使用Bootstrap等框架来快速构建响应式布局和样式。
使用jQuery Mobile等框架来简化JavaScript编程和交互设计。
使用PhoneGap等工具来打包和发布移动应用程序,实现跨平台的目标。
四、优化性能和用户体验
优化图片大小和加载速度,例如使用压缩和缓存技术。
优化页面加载速度,例如使用异步加载和懒加载技术。
优化交互性能,例如减少页面重绘和避免阻塞渲染。
提供离线访问功能,使得用户可以在无网络环境下使用应用程序。
提供友好的用户界面和易于使用的交互方式,例如提供明确的操作按钮和提示信息。
提供多语言支持,满足不同国家和地区用户的需求。
提供安全性和隐私保护措施,例如加密数据传输和保护用户个人信息。
广州天河区珠江新城富力盈力大厦北塔2706
020-38013166(网站咨询专线)
400-001-5281 (售后服务热线)
深圳市坂田十二橡树庄园F1-7栋
Site/ http://www.szciya.com
E-mail/ itciya@vip.163.com
品牌服务专线:400-001-5281
长沙市天心区芙蓉中路三段398号新时空大厦5楼
联系电话/ (+86 0731)88282200
品牌服务专线/ 400-966-8830
旗下运营网站:
Copyright © 2016 广州思洋文化传播有限公司,保留所有权利。 粤ICP备09033321号